People with disabilities have made a name for themselves in the painting world. From Frida Kahlo to Dan Keplinger, people with disabilities have found painting as a way to express themselves. In turn, millions of art lovers all over the world have embraced them. Painting is a great hobby for people with disabilities because it’s accessible. You can do it at home, it s a way to express your pains and joys in life, and no matter your disability; you can do it.
Create a painting method that works for youPeople with mobility disabilities have come up with the most creative ways to paint. Thousands of paralyzed painters all over the world use whatever body part they can to paint. From their feet to their mouths, it doesn’t matter as long as their brush caresses the easel.
